Nuggets’ Nene out with bruised right heel

The Columbian
Published: January 19, 2012, 4:00pm

WASHINGTON (AP) — Denver Nuggets forward Nene is out of Friday’s game against the Washington Wizards with a bruised right heel. Nene previously missed three games with a bruised left foot.

Coach George Karl said he expects Nene to play against former teammate Carmelo Anthony when the Nuggets visit the New York Knicks on Saturday night.

Kosta Koufos will start in Nene’s place and Timofey Mozgov will return to the starting lineup. Mozgov started the first 14 games, but missed Wednesday’s game in Philadelphia with a strained back.

Rudy Fernandez, who’s missed the last two games with a strained right Achilles, is expected to play against Washington, Karl said.

Denver is playing four games in five nights.
